The origin of the clan Charles Kingston, a Salt Lake City man who belonged to the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ints, better known as Mormons, was excommunicated in 1929 for practicing polygamy. WebKingston is a member of the Order, the largest Mormon polygamist clan in the U.S. Authorities call it an organized crime group. Concentrated in Salt Lake City, its 10,000 members control more than 100 businesses in the West, including a casino in Southern California and a cattle ranch on the Nevada border.
